Transaction 852215b44aeaf120183a12dabebecef35fd07a5f61cea8782930d12c98c32889
1 Input
1 Output
-
852215b44aeaf120183a12dabebecef35fd07a5f61cea8782930d12c98c32889:0
- value
- 14556
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 18cc0e351383bb29104261867a708a3ac33898792428add27df6ed2a5ec7a9ad
- address
- bc1prrxqudgnswajjyzzvxr85uy28tpn3xreys52m5na7mkj5hk84xksc24d2t